How they compare

Vanuatu currently reports 10 t against 7 t in Norway, a difference of 3 t.

That makes Vanuatu's figure about 1.4 times Norway's.

The two have swapped places 5 times across 15 shared years of data; in 1999 it was Norway ahead.

Norway ranks 111th and Vanuatu ranks 109th of 120 countries.

Across the 3 decades both report, Norway averaged higher in 2 and Vanuatu in 1.

The database contains data on the bilateral trade flows in roundwood, prim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world. The main types of primary forest products included in are: ro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further. The definitions are available.
